On Fri, Jan 13, 2023 at 06:26:00PM -0300, Fabio Estevam wrote: > Hi, > > I am trying to upgrade U-Boot to 2023.01 in OpenEmbedded, but I see > the following error when trying to build u-boot-tools: > > | /bin/sh: line 1: tools/bmp_logo: No such file or directory > > Reverting the commit below makes u-boot-tools build again: > > commit 1cfba53ca46cade2dbf4e067afc8c19e72909a4b > Author: Peter Robinson <[email protected]> > Date: Thu Nov 24 14:05:59 2022 +0000 > > config: tools only: add VIDEO to build bmp_logo > > Pre 2023.01 the bmp_logo was built as part of the tools-only_defconfig > build, something changed and the VIDEO dep needed to build it > is no longer pulled in so fix that by explicitly defining it. > > Signed-off-by: Peter Robinson <[email protected]> > Reviewed-by: Simon Glass <[email protected]> > > u-boot-tools-native builds fine though. > > What would be the correct way to fix this?
Vagrant also hit this for Debian as Fedora cross-builds bmp_logo and ships it in host tools, but the logo header files that we generate with bmp_logo need the tool host built. And the same flag, VIDEO_LOGO (default y if VIDEO, basically) controls both the tool and the headers. I think the first thing to figure out is if bmp_logo should be shipped as a host tool, or not. -- Tom
